About agriculture in Santiago Lalopa

Santiago Lalopa is located in the Sierra Norte region of the state of Oaxaca, Mexico. The surrounding landscape is characterized by rugged mountain terrain, deep valleys, and dense cloud forests, which create a humid and temperate environment. The rural areas are defined by their steep slopes and isolated patches of fertile land nestled within the Sierra Juárez range.

Agricultural activities in the area are primarily centered around coffee production, which is the main economic driver for local families. Small-scale farmers utilize the altitude and climate to grow high-quality beans under the shade of native trees. In addition to coffee, subsistence farming is common, with crops such as maize, beans, and squash grown in traditional milpas, alongside small orchards of citrus and temperate fruits.

For farm workers and agronomists, seasonal demand peaks during the coffee harvest, which typically occurs in the cooler months. Jobs often involve manual harvesting and processing in challenging, steep environments, requiring good physical endurance. Agronomists coming to this region often focus on supporting smallholder cooperatives, improving sustainable farming practices, and managing crop health in a high-humidity mountain climate.
